Benfica eyeing Amorim, but face competition from Sporting

Benfica - which has a well-identified target - is interested in Alex Amorim, a midfielder currently shining at Alverca. The information is reported by the newspaper O Jogo, noting that the Eagles are closely following the development of the young Brazilian. The Clube da Luz aims to get ahead of direct competitors to secure the South American talent for the main squad.
The potential signing would only be for the next season. It is important to note that the player's rights are divided: 50% belongs to the Ribatejo club and the other half is owned by Fortaleza. This contractual detail could complicate negotiations with Custódio's team, as the added value would be reduced.
Sporting also has the player on their radar, promising a fierce battle in the transfer market. Besides the Lions, Milan and PSV are monitoring the star, with inquiries also coming from English clubs. The competition is fierce, as the player's performance has attracted the interest of several European giants.
Despite the various options for the midfield area, such as Barrenechea, Leandro Barreiro, Richard Ríos, Fredrik Aursnes, or Manu Silva, the Benfica management has great faith in the player's abilities. The technical staff believes that the midfielder possesses unique characteristics to add quality and creativity to José Mourinho's team's offensive play.
This season, playing for Alverca, Alex Amorim – valued at 2.5 million euros – has played 19 games: 17 in the Liga Portugal Betclic, one in the Portuguese Cup, and one in the League Cup. In the 1,603 minutes he was on the field, the player, who is under contract until June 2028, scored two goals.
